Common Issues with Virgin Media Super Hub 4 Firmware Update Problems
- Connectivity issues: Some users have reported intermittent or dropped connections, making it difficult to access the internet.
- Performance problems: Others have experienced slow speeds, lag, or buffering, which can be frustrating when streaming or downloading content.
- Functional issues: Some customers have reported problems with router settings, Wi-Fi connectivity, or device recognition, which can be a nuisance.

Causes of Virgin Media Super Hub 4 Firmware Update Problems
There are several reasons why you might be experiencing issues with your Virgin Media Super Hub 4 firmware update. Some possible causes include:
- Software conflicts: The new firmware update may have caused compatibility issues with your existing router settings or devices.
- Hardware problems: The Super Hub 4's hardware may be faulty or outdated, leading to performance issues or connectivity problems.
- Incorrect installation: If the firmware update was not installed correctly, it may have caused problems with your router's functionality.
